Women's Soccer Advances to SAA Semifinal

MOUNT BERRY, Ga. - Women's Soccer was in action on Saturday afternoon for their Southern Athletic Association quarterfinal match with the Oglethorpe Stormy Petrels, where they took advantage of a hot start to the second half, winning it 2-1.  

The first half was a defensive battle, as neither team could push the ball through the back of the net. Both teams were able to get some momentum going with a total of six shots in the first half from the Vikings and 8 from Oglethorpe. The Vikings also had key players go down with injuries in the first half, as they had to play the second half without Nicole Knight and Mia Ries

The Vikings came out on a mission in the second half. In the 46th minute, Ide Strickland orchestrated a beautiful corner kick that was flawlessly headed into the back of the net by Chloe Benoist. As the crowd went wild, you could feel the energy shift in favor of Berry.  

Five minutes later, another corner kick would prove to be productive for the Vikings as a couple of passes following the corner would lead Maddie Owen to find herself with space just outside the penalty box. Owen then sent in a marvelous shot, just over the outstretched arms of the Oglethorpe goalkeeper and into the net, giving the Vikings a commanding 2-0 lead.  

Oglethorpe finally answered with 31 minutes to go in the second half, cutting the Berry lead to 1. This would be as close as the Stormy Petrels would come, as the Vikings controlled the final thirty minutes with strong defensive plays from Olivia Bryan, Annie Connors, and Kelsie Crosier.  

The Vikings will advance to the SAA Semifinals to take on the Rhodes Lynx in Sewanee, Tennessee, on Friday November 8th. With a win there, the Vikings can advance to the SAA Championship game.
